What is the simplified form of the expression? k3 [k^7/3] -5

Simplify the following:
(k^3 k^7)/3 - 5

Combine powers. (k^3 k^7)/3 = k^(7 + 3)/3:
k^(7 + 3)/3 - 5

7 + 3 = 10:
k^10/3 - 5

Put each term in k^10/3 - 5 over the common denominator 3: k^10/3 - 5 = k^10/3 - 15/3:
k^10/3 - 15/3

k^10/3 - 15/3 = (k^10 - 15)/3:
Answer: (k^10 - 15)/3
